TY - JOUR T1 - Neuroanatomical underpinning of diffusion kurtosis measurements in the cerebral cortex of healthy macaque brains JF - bioRxiv DO - 10.1101/2020.07.25.221093 SP - 2020.07.25.221093 AU - Tianjia Zhu AU - Qinmu Peng AU - Austin Ouyang AU - Hao Huang Y1 - 2020/01/01 UR - http://biorxiv.org/content/early/2020/10/07/2020.07.25.221093.abstract N2 - Purpose To investigate the neuroanatomical underpinning of healthy macaque brain cortical microstructure measured by diffusion kurtosis imaging (DKI) which characterizes non-Gaussian water diffusion.Methods High-resolution DKI was acquired from 6 postmortem macaque brains. Neurofilament density (ND) was quantified based on structure tensor from neurofilament histological images of a different macaque brain sample. After alignment of DKI-derived mean kurtosis (MK) maps to the histological images, MK and histology-based ND were measured at corresponding regions of interests characterized by distinguished cortical MK values in the prefrontal/precentral-postcentral and temporal cortices. Pearson correlation was performed to test significant correlation between these cortical MK and ND measurements.Results Heterogeneity of cortical MK across different cortical regions was revealed, with significantly and consistently higher MK measurements in the prefrontal/precentral-postcentral cortex compared to those in the temporal cortex across all 6 scanned macaque brains. Corresponding higher ND measurements in the prefrontal/precentral-postcentral cortex than in the temporal cortex were also found. The heterogeneity of cortical MK is associated with heterogeneity of histology-based ND measurements, with significant correlation between cortical MK and corresponding ND measurements (P <0.005).Conclusion These findings suggested that DKI-derived MK can potentially be an effective noninvasive biomarker quantifying underlying neuroanatomical complexity inside the cerebral cortical mantle for clinical and neuroscientific research.Competing Interest StatementThe authors have declared no competing interest.
